Tens of thousands of refugees have fled the Tigray region of Ethiopia after violence erupted in early November 2020.
Most didn’t manage to bring anything with them, just the clothes on their bodies. They still don’t know what happened to what they left behind.
Our teams began triaging and treating people on 5 November in the Amhara region of Ethiopia and providing emergency medical care to people who have fled across the border into Sudan.
People fleeing the violence are still in urgent need of medical care, shelter, water and food.
